Quality Assurance Framework
Commonly used in Quality Assurance
A Quality Assurance Framework is a comprehensive set of guidelines and practices established to ensure that a product or service consistently meets specified quality standards. It provides a structured approach to identifying, preventing, and resolving issues related to quality throughout the development or delivery process.
How It Works
The framework typically includes defined procedures for testing, inspection, and validation of products or services at various stages. It involves creating detailed documentation that outlines quality objectives, standards, and responsibilities. Regular review processes are integrated to monitor compliance and effectiveness, allowing teams to identify areas for improvement. Implementing a quality assurance framework often involves training staff, setting up quality metrics, and establishing feedback loops to continuously enhance quality levels.
Common Use Cases
- Developing software applications with systematic testing and bug tracking processes.
- Manufacturing products with quality checkpoints and inspection routines.
- Providing customer support services with standardized complaint handling and resolution procedures.
- Implementing compliance processes for industry standards and regulations.
- Conducting audits and reviews to verify adherence to quality policies across departments.
